#2149f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2149fb is composed of 12.9% red, 28.6%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 229 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 55.7%. #2149fb color hex could be obtained by blending #4292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2149f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000209 is the darkest color, while #f5f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2149fb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b93 is the less saturated color, while #2149fb is the most saturated one.
